摘要

针对基于背景减法和虚拟环路的交通流统计算法存在的一些不足,根据车辆进出虚拟环路时帧间相似度的变化规律,提出了基于帧间相似度的交通流统计算法,该算法能够克服两个问题:一是由于部分检测目标与背景颜色接近而漏检;另一个是由于速度过低导致的重复检测,然后利用该算法对实验结果进行验证。

Research on Traffic Flow Statistics Algorithm Based on Inter - Frame Similarity
Considering some existing shortcomings in traffic flow statistics algorithm based on background subtraction and virtual loop, according to the change discipline of inter-frame similarity while vehicles passing in and out the virtual loop, we come up with a traffic flow statistics algorithm based on inter - frame similarity, which is able to overcome two problems: one is missed inspection since some detection targets are close to background color; the other one is repeated detection resulting from over-low speed, then we carry out the experimental results by using the algorithm.
